Description
| Specification | Details |
|---|---|
| Model Number | LT-750 |
| Measurement Range | –180.00° to +180.00° (Optical Rotation) |
| Resolution | 0.001° |
| Accuracy | ±0.01° |
| Light Source | Sodium D-Line LED (589 nm) |
| Display | Bright LCD with digital readout for optical rotation, specific rotation, concentration, and temperature |
| Sample Tube Support | Compatible with 100 mm and 200 mm tubes (various diameters) |
| Temperature Control | Integrated sensor with automatic compensation |
| Calibration | Electronic auto-calibration |
| Data Export | USB and RS-232 output for external system integration |
| Power Supply | 230V ±10%, 50 Hz |
| Build Quality | Rugged, dust- and moisture-resistant enclosure |
| Software Integration | Compatible with LIMS and other laboratory data systems |
| Safety Features | Safety interlocks, overload protection, and auto-shutdown mode |

High Precision Meets Automation
At the core of the LT-750 is a sophisticated microprocessor-controlled optical system utilizing a sodium D-line LED light source, optimized polarizing components, and sensitive detectors. The instrument ensures real-time, noise-free readings, essential for assessing optically active compounds such as sugars, amino acids, APIs, essential oils, and raw chemicals.
The fully automatic operation handles tasks like sample alignment, optical reading, and result calculation. By reducing manual steps, the LT-750 improves lab efficiency, minimizes human error, and enhances throughput—especially in high-volume or regulated environments.
Accurate Temperature Compensation
Temperature fluctuations can distort polarimetric data. That’s why the LT-750 includes an integrated temperature sensor and automated temperature compensation system, delivering reliable results even in non-controlled environments. This feature ensures reproducibility and consistency—critical for GLP/GMP-compliant labs.

Application Areas
-
Pharmaceutical Quality Control – Ensures chiral purity and compliance with pharmacopeial standards.
-
Food & Beverage Testing – Accurate determination of sugar concentration and product authenticity.
-
Chemical Manufacturing – Purity verification of raw materials and finished batches.
-
Academic & Research Institutions – Ideal for stereochemistry, chirality demonstrations, and student training.
